Let f: A → B, such that f ( x) = y, with x ∈ A, y ∈ B. Then its inverse is a function such that f − 1 maps from the codomain of f to the domain of f, this is: f − 1: B → A So, ∀ y ∈ B, f − 1 ( y) = x, with x ∈ A. Alternatively, By definition of inverse mapping: f − 1 ( y) = x
